Isle soldier's death in Iraq spurs Army investigation

The military is investigating the death of a 25-year-old Schofield Barracks soldier who was killed Tuesday in Iraq.

;

Sgt. Devin C. Poche, 25, of Jacksonville, N.C., died Tuesday at Contingency Operating Base Speicher near Tikrit of injuries sustained from a noncombat-related incident, the Pentagon reported yesterday. No other details were released by the Army.

He was assigned to the 3rd Brigade Combat Team's Special Troops Battalion.

Poche joined the Army in February 2005 and was assigned to Schofield Barracks in October 2005.

He is the fourth soldier from the 3rd Brigade to die since the unit was deployed to Iraq in November, and the second to die from noncombat injuries.

On Jan. 11, Pvt. Sean P. McCune, 20, of Euless, Texas, was killed in an accidental rifle shooting in Samarra. The Army still has not released details of the shooting.

The brigade is serving its second combat tour in Iraq. Thirty-six soldiers serving with the 3rd Brigade and other Schofield Barracks units died during the first deployment, which ended in October 2007.
